University of Louisville
Monday, January 15, 2024
The University of Louisville seeks a Post-Doctoral Research Fellow for a newly funded NASA project, “Synthesis Study of Land Cover, Land Use, and Demographic Change under Multi-Dimensional Developments and Climate Pressures in Southeast Asia,” to supplement expertise in earth-observation processing, sociodemographic modeling and cloud computing integration and synthesize understanding of the dynamics and interactions of the complex changes in the biophysical and socioeconomic systems along the rural-urban continuum. Deadline: Open until filled

Research Institute for Humanity and Nature (RIHN)
Friday, January 12, 2024
The RIHN Visiting Research Fellow Program brings overseas researchers to the Institute in Kyoto, Japan for periods of two to six months to engage in specific research in the context of one of the RIHN Research Programs, Research Projects or Units of RIHN Center and Strategic Planning and Management Department. Deadline: 12 January 2024
